PER CURIAM.
Appellant, Stephen Jerome Tolbert, appeals his conviction for possession of cocaine under section 893.101, Florida Statutes (2003), arguing that a jury instruction failed to instruct the jury that knowledge of the illicit nature of the controlled substance is an element of the crime, therefore rendering section 893.101 unconstitutional.
